@media (min-width:992px) and (max-width:1199px){.navbar{background:rgba(0,0,0,.7);padding:0}.navbar-nav{float:left}.vesco-nav-wrapper{padding:0}}@media (min-width:768px) and (max-width:991px){.navbar{background:rgba(0,0,0,.7);padding:0}.navbar-nav{float:left}.vesco-nav-wrapper{padding:0}#about-bg-diagonal{border-left:0;border-top:0;width:100%;height:350px}#about-content-box{width:100%;height:350px;margin-top:75px}#work .content-box{margin-top:75px}.stats-item{padding:20px 0}#footer-copyrights{text-align:center}}@media (max-width:767px){.navbar{background:rgba(0,0,0,.7);padding:0}.navbar-nav{float:left}.row.no-gutters [class*=col-]{margin:2px}.vesco-nav-wrapper{padding:0}#home-heading h3{font-size:24px}.btn-general{padding:6px 22px 6px 22px;font-size:14px}#about-bg-diagonal{border-left:0;border-top:0;width:100%;height:350px}#about-content-box{width:100%;height:350px;margin-top:50px}.img-wrapper img{min-width:100%}#work .content-box{margin-top:100px}.testimonial blockquote{padding:6px 50px}.testimonial blockquote:before{left:10px}.testimonial blockquote:after{right:10px}.testimonial blockquote p{font-size:14px}.stats-item{padding:20px 0}#footer-copyrights{text-align:center}}@media (max-width:480px){.logo a{font-weight:600;font-size:2.5 rem;color:#ddd;font-style:normal}.navbar-brand{padding-top:15px;padding-bottom:15px;padding-left:0;margin-left:0;font-size:15px;line-height:20px;height:50px}.service-item-icon i{width:57px;height:57px;padding:7px}.service-item-title h3{font-size:17px}#about-content-box{margin-top:40px}.testimonial img{max-width:80px}.testimonial blockquote{padding:6px 30px}.testimonial blockquote:before{left:7px}.testimonial blockquote:after{right:7px}#work .content-box{margin-top:220px}.row.no-gutters [class*=col-]{margin:2px}}